Deep Dive into MozBar Page Authority
MozBar Page Authority (PA) is a metric developed by Moz that predicts how well a specific page will rank on search engine result pages (SERPs). It’s based on a machine learning algorithm that analyzes various factors, including the number of linking root domains, total number of links, and MozRank. PA scores range from 1 to 100, with higher scores indicating a greater likelihood of ranking well. It’s important to remember that Page Authority is a predictive score, not a definitive measure of ranking. It serves as a valuable benchmark for assessing the potential of individual pages.
Unlike Domain Authority, which assesses the strength of an entire domain, Page Authority focuses specifically on the ranking potential of a single page. This makes it a valuable tool for optimizing individual pieces of content and identifying areas for improvement on specific pages. Core Concepts and Advanced Principles:
Page Authority is calculated using a complex algorithm that takes into account a variety of factors related to the linking profile of a specific page. These factors include:
- MozRank: A measure of the link equity a page receives.
- MozTrust: A measure of the trustworthiness of the sites linking to the page.
- Number of Linking Root Domains: The number of unique domains linking to the page.
- Total Number of Links: The total number of links pointing to the page.
The algorithm then uses this data to predict the likelihood of the page ranking well in search results. It’s important to note that Page Authority is a relative metric, meaning that it’s best used to compare the ranking potential of different pages rather than as an absolute measure of success. For example, comparing two pages on your own site, or comparing your page to a competitor’s.
To improve your Page Authority, focus on building high-quality backlinks from authoritative websites. This involves creating valuable content that other websites will want to link to, as well as actively promoting your content to relevant audiences. Remember that Page Authority is just one factor in the overall ranking algorithm, so it’s important to also focus on other aspects of SEO, such as keyword optimization, content quality, and user experience.

Moz Pro: The Tool Behind MozBar Page Authority
Moz Pro is a comprehensive suite of SEO tools designed to help website owners and marketers improve their search engine visibility. It includes a range of features, including keyword research, rank tracking, site audits, and link analysis. The MozBar, a free browser extension, is a simplified version that provides instant access to key SEO metrics, including Page Authority and Domain Authority, directly from your browser.

Detailed Features Analysis of Moz Pro and MozBar
Moz Pro offers a wide array of features designed to enhance your SEO efforts. Here’s a breakdown of some key functionalities:
- Keyword Research: Moz Pro provides tools to discover relevant keywords, analyze their search volume, and assess their difficulty. This helps you target the right keywords for your content and optimize your website for relevant search queries.
- Rank Tracking: Monitor your website’s ranking for specific keywords over time. This allows you to track the effectiveness of your SEO efforts and identify areas where you need to improve.
- Site Audits: Identify technical SEO issues that may be hindering your website’s performance. Moz Pro scans your website for errors, broken links, and other issues that can impact your search engine ranking.
- Link Analysis: Analyze your website’s backlink profile and identify opportunities to build high-quality links. Moz Pro provides insights into the number of linking root domains, the authority of those domains, and the anchor text used in the links.
- Page Authority and Domain Authority: As we’ve discussed, these metrics provide valuable insights into the ranking potential of individual pages and entire domains.
- On-Page Optimization: Moz Pro provides recommendations for optimizing your content and website structure to improve your search engine ranking.
- Competitive Analysis: Analyze your competitors’ websites and identify their strengths and weaknesses. This allows you to develop a competitive SEO strategy and identify opportunities to outperform them.
For example, the Keyword Research tool allows you to enter a seed keyword and generate a list of related keywords, along with their search volume and difficulty scores. This helps you identify long-tail keywords that are less competitive and easier to rank for. The Site Audit tool identifies broken links, missing title tags, and other technical issues that can negatively impact your search engine ranking. Addressing these issues can significantly improve your website’s overall SEO performance.

Question: How often should I check my MozBar Page Authority, and what actions should I take based on the data?
Answer: Checking your PA monthly is a good starting point. If you see a decline, investigate potential backlink losses or algorithm updates. If you see an increase, analyze what contributed to the improvement and replicate those efforts.
-
Question: How does MozBar Page Authority differ from Domain Authority (DA), and which metric is more important?
Answer: PA measures the ranking potential of a single page, while DA measures the overall strength of a domain. Neither is inherently more important; PA is useful for optimizing individual pages, while DA provides a broader overview of your website’s authority.
-
Question: Can a brand new page have a high MozBar Page Authority immediately?
Answer: It’s unlikely. PA is built upon backlinks and other factors that take time to accumulate. A new page will typically start with a low PA and gradually increase as it earns backlinks.
-
Question: What are some common mistakes people make when trying to improve their MozBar Page Authority?
Answer: Common mistakes include focusing solely on quantity of backlinks over quality, neglecting on-page optimization, and ignoring user experience. A holistic approach is key.
-
Question: How does Google use Page Authority in ranking websites?
Answer: Google does not directly use MozBar’s Page Authority. However, Google has its own set of metrics to determine the ranking of websites. MozBar’s PA is a prediction of how well a specific page will rank on search engine result pages (SERPs) based on a number of factors.
